Born from the 2025 Los Angeles fires, Ashes To Films is a nonprofit organization dedicated to supporting artists and communities impacted by disaster. Ashes to Films provides funding, mentorship, resources, and a platform to help rebuild creative lives through storytelling and showcase stories of resilience.

Read MoreNorth East Trees is an environmental non-profit that makes Los Angeles greener and greater. They hire and train young adults from under-served areas to help design (lose use) and build parks, plant street trees, educate the public, and work with native plants at their nursery. Their mission is to increase the urban canopy, battle thermal inequity, and launch sustainable "green" careers.
